出 处:《云南化工》2020年第7期48-49,共2页Yunnan Chemical Technology
摘 要:根据相似相溶的原理,运用无水乙醇来回收沉淀废渣中的乳化液,经过做实验找到了一条绿色、高效、无污染的回收工艺。通过单因素控制实验确定了该回收工艺的最佳工艺条件为:液固比为10,洗涤温度40℃,洗涤时间为2 h,乳化液回收率可达到98.18%,分离后分离得到的铝粉,铁粉,乳化液均有利用价值,旋蒸回收的乙醇可以再次循环利用。Based on the principle of similar solubility,this paper uses anhydrous ethanol to recover the emulsion from the waste residue.A Green,efficient and pollution-free recovery process has been found.The optimum conditions of the recovery process were determined by single factor control experiment:The liquid-solid ratio was 10,the washing temperature was40 temperture,the washing time was 2 hours,the recovery of the emulsion could reach 98.18%,the emulsions are valuable,and the ethanol recovered by rotary evaporation can be recycled again.
